Understanding the Core Mechanics
At its heart, the game is remarkably straightforward. Players begin by placing a bet before each round. A plane then appears on screen and begins to ascend. As it gains altitude, a multiplier increases. This multiplier is the key to potential winnings. The longer the plane stays aloft, the higher the multiplier climbs. However, this ascent isn’t indefinite. The plane can ‘crash’ at any moment, and if this happens after you’ve bet, you lose your stake. The thrill comes from deciding when to ‘cash out’ and secure your earnings. Strategic timing and risk assessment are crucial for success.

Understanding Autocash Out Features
Many platforms now offer automated cash-out features allowing players to pre-set a multiplier level at which their bet is automatically cashed out. This can be incredibly useful for those who wish to remove the emotional element from the game and implement a strategy consistently. However, it’s essential to fully understand how these features work. Some platforms allow for multiple autocash-outs to be set for a single bet, splitting your winnings across different multipliers. Before relying on autocash, thoroughly test the feature in demo mode to confirm it functions as expected. Furthermore, be aware that changes to the game may also change how this feature operates.

The Psychology of the Aviator Game
The aviator game’s appeal encompasses psychological elements alongside its straightforward mechanics. The escalating multiplier creates a strong sense of anticipation and excitement, stimulating a dopamine rush with each increasing value. This can be addictive, encouraging players to push their luck further in pursuit of larger rewards. The near-miss effect – where the plane crashes just after you cash out – can also be particularly impactful, further fueling the desire for another round. Understanding these psychological factors is key to maintaining a rational and responsible approach to the game, and recognizing when to walk away.
